Quick Release Low-Profile Ac Input Filter

US Patent:
2005013, Jun 23, 2005
Filed:
Dec 22, 2003
Appl. No.:
10/744196
Inventors:
Matthew Moore - Columbia SC, US
International Classification:
H02H009/06
US Classification:
361118000
Abstract:
Methods and associated apparatus of providing a low profile, quick disconnect AC filter are described. Those methods comprise providing a low profile AC filter that is attached within a housing at a first position, pivoting the AC filter to a second position by applying a first force to a power cable connected to the AC filter in a direction away from the housing, and removing the power cable from the AC filter by applying a second force to the power cable, wherein the AC filter is returned to the first position.
